Dr. Richardson-Barlow frequently speaks on issues related to energy policy, global market and policy developments concerning energy and the environment, and energy security and climate issues in the Asia-Pacific region. She has presented at domestic and international academic and policy conferences alike and she frequently speaks to media around the world, including BBC News Insight, The Diplomat, and the China Daily.
Recent international conference appearances include the Royal Geographic Society (RGS), the Korea International Renewable Energy Conference co-hosted by REN21 and the South Korean Ministry of Trade, Industry and Energy of Korea (MOTIE), the Transforming Foundation Industries’ conference on Resource Efficiency and Circular Economy, and the China Institute of International Studies’ (CIIS) annual Young China Scholars conference hosted by the Chinese Ministry of Foreign Affairs, among others.
